Soup Kitchens
We have over 70 feeding projects located in various disadvantaged areas in Gauteng. These soup kitchens are run by our congregation members and home fellowship group leaders and Hands of Compassion provides assistance with food vouchers. Our soup kitchen coordinator, collects food from various stores e.g. Woolworths, Spar, home industries, and re-distributes it to the various areas.
Food distribution is done weekly to schools, organizations and informal settlements in and around Lanseria, as well as to the sick who visit our clinic. Much of this food is collected from Woolworths. (Thank you Woolworths!)
Hands of Compassion at the Church
A walk-in soup kitchen and bible study are held daily at the Church for people living on the streets. Counseling and assistance is given to anyone in need.
At our Food and Clothing Depot members of our congregation bring in clothing and food for distribution to the poor.
Emergency Rooms are set aside for overnight accommodation at the Church (cnr Hans Schoeman and Rabie Streets, Randpark Ridge, Randburg).
